public static void SetSchema(DockPanel dockPanel, Extender.Schema schema) { if (schema == Extender.Schema.VS2005) { dockPanel.Extender.AutoHideStripFactory = null; dockPanel.Extender.DockPaneCaptionFactory = null; dockPanel.Extender.DockPaneStripFactory = null; } else if (schema == Extender.Schema.VS2003) { dockPanel.Extender.DockPaneCaptionFactory = new VS2003DockPaneCaptionFactory(); dockPanel.Extender.AutoHideStripFactory = new VS2003AutoHideStripFactory(); dockPanel.Extender.DockPaneStripFactory = new VS2003DockPaneStripFactory(); } }
private void SetSchema(object sender, System.EventArgs e) { CloseAllContents(); if (sender == schemaVS2005ToolStripMenuItem) { Extender.SetSchema(dockPanel, Extender.Schema.VS2005); } else if (sender == schemaVS2003ToolStripMenuItem) { Extender.SetSchema(dockPanel, Extender.Schema.VS2003); } schemaVS2005ToolStripMenuItem.Checked = (sender == schemaVS2005ToolStripMenuItem); schemaVS2003ToolStripMenuItem.Checked = (sender == schemaVS2003ToolStripMenuItem); }